Electrical engineers have a well-paying
career as they are responsible for designing, maintaining, implementing, and
improving all electrical instruments and equipment that you can think of. Here is
a list of top 10 universities if you wish to pursue Electrical Engineering in USA.
1.
Massachusetts Institute of Technology
MIT has awarded electrical engineering
degrees to thousands of students for nearly 130 years, and the educational
programs here are cutting edge, since their inception. Here, you can gain the knowledge
and skills needed to secure jobs in Information Technology, mobile phone
troubleshooting, power plant design, engineering companies, and many others.
2. Stanford
University
The EE program of Stanford University
emphasizes technical knowledge as well as laboratory and design skills. While
the undergraduate majors focus on the electrical engineering principles along
with the required supporting knowledge of computing, engineering basics,
mathematics, and science, the master’s program provide students an opportunity to
specialize in one area of Electrical Engineering.

8. Princeton
University
The department of Electrical Engineering in
Princeton University offers two degree programs. The doctoral (Ph.D.) program
prepares students for a variety of careers in research, teaching, and advanced
development. The Master of Engineering (M.Eng.) program is designed for
students interested in careers in engineering practices or technical
management.
